GD&T - Assumptions when mating part tolerances unknown? by ForumFollower in MechanicalEngineering

[–]gdtnerd 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Few thoughts: Look up standard tolerances for the type of process to create the COTS part. Add some buffer to that number. And then tolerance to that.

Sometimes in electronic parts or connectors they girlie you a definition of what your part needs to be.

Contact the manufacturer and ask them this directly. Someone in engineering might be able to answer.

If possible you could study a few and try to establish some statistics from samples. This won't be perfect but probably would work.

What GD&T for the block? by Spiritual_Yak5933 in MechanicalEngineering

[–]gdtnerd 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Based on what i see.

Datum A to the surface where they clamp together. Fatness control of this surface

Datum B across the feature of size consisting of the long dimension of this block. To create a derived median plane

Datum c doing the same thing but on the thickness aligned with into the picture. This gets you setup to center your hole pattern to the overall block. Even material around the blocks and holes help prevent unforseen problems.

The 2x hole pattern becomes Datum D.

The semi circle gets a surface profile called to it and reference A and D.

This will follow its use. The bolts line up and block the blocks, and the profiles follow it for clamping.

Bonus points: calculate your true position values using floating fastener if the holes are thru or fixed fastener if one set has blind tapped holes
